Abstract
本实用新型公开了一种多自由度小儿截石位体位架,包括固定卡、立杆和连接杆,所述的立杆设置一对,通过连接杆连接;立杆的底部活动式安装在固定卡中,连接杆上设置一对可沿连接杆轴向滑动的支杆,支杆底部通过万向装置设置有腿托。本实用新型整个体位架的各个角度均可以调整,如体位架的角度、腿托的高度、角度、双腿间打开的程度等,极大地方便了手术操作,医生可根据实际手术需要对患者下肢姿态、位置、角度等进行方便的调整,更好地暴露术野;结构简单,制作、安装方便,且可以直接平放于床尾,收纳方便。
The utility model discloses a multi-degree-of-freedom lithotomy position frame for children, which comprises a fixed card, a vertical rod and a connecting rod. A pair of vertical rods are arranged and connected through the connecting rod; the bottom of the vertical rod is movable and installed on a fixed In the card, a pair of struts that can slide axially along the connecting rod are arranged on the connecting rod, and the bottom of the struts is provided with a leg rest through a universal device. All angles of the entire body position frame of the utility model can be adjusted, such as the angle of the body position frame, the height and angle of the leg support, the degree of opening between the legs, etc., which greatly facilitates the operation. The doctor can adjust the lower limbs of the patient according to the actual operation needs. Posture, position, angle, etc. can be adjusted conveniently to better expose the surgical field; the structure is simple, easy to manufacture and install, and can be directly placed flat at the end of the bed for easy storage.

背景技术Background technique
截石位是一种手术常用的取位,其基本姿势是病人仰卧,双腿放在支架上,将臀部移到床边,以最大程度地暴露会阴,在治疗如先天性肛门闭锁以及巨结肠的手术中有着重要的应用。The lithotomy position is a commonly used position for surgery. The basic posture is that the patient lies supine, puts his legs on the support, and moves the buttocks to the bedside to expose the perineum to the greatest extent. In the treatment of congenital anal atresia and megacolon important applications in surgery.
传统的截石位体架,一般包括一个固定在手术床边的侧力臂,侧力臂部设置有横力臂,横力臂下端通过纱布或约束带吊住患儿的腿部。这种体位架严格上来讲不是专门用于截石位的体位架,功能单一,并且由于其是单侧固定,负重能力有限,稳定性差,前、后以及上下活动受限,下端约束带与患儿腿部接触的面积较小,使患儿腿部重量都集中在于约束带接触的部位。The traditional lithotomy position frame generally includes a side arm fixed on the side of the operating bed. The side arm is provided with a transverse arm, and the lower end of the transverse arm hangs the child's leg through gauze or a restraint belt. Strictly speaking, this kind of body position frame is not specially used for lithotomy position. It has a single function, and because it is fixed on one side, its load-bearing capacity is limited, its stability is poor, and its front, back, and up and down movements are limited. The contact area of the child's legs is small, so that the weight of the child's legs is concentrated on the part where the restraint belt contacts.
另外,由于这种单侧的体位架只能使患儿的单侧腿部抬起,并不能充分暴露会阴部,术中铺单困难,长时间悬吊患儿下肢,使患儿的骨骼肌、肌肉、神经遭到长时间牵拉,严重影响患儿下肢血液循环。In addition, since this unilateral body position frame can only lift one leg of the child, and cannot fully expose the perineum, it is difficult to lay the drape during the operation, and the lower limbs of the child are suspended for a long time, which makes the skeletal muscles of the child , muscles, and nerves are stretched for a long time, which seriously affects the blood circulation of the children's lower extremities.
截石位手术要求患者腿部的姿势、角度能根据手术的需要进行方便的调整,以方便手术同时定时改变姿势促进患儿下肢循环,但目前的体位架显然不能满足上述要求,使用过程不能达到满意的效果,常出现腓总神经或肌肉损伤的情况。Lithotomy position surgery requires that the posture and angle of the patient's legs can be adjusted conveniently according to the needs of the operation, so as to facilitate the operation and change the posture regularly to promote the circulation of the children's lower limbs. Satisfactory results, common peroneal nerve or muscle damage often occurs.

具体实施方式Detailed ways
在实际的截石位手术中,患者的姿态在很大程度上影响着手术的进程,同时不合适的腿部姿态也容易给患者带来腿部循环问题或者肌肉拉伤问题。因此,在手术过程中对于腿部姿态的调整显得尤为重要,并且这个调整应该是多自由度的,即不同的角度、方向上均能进行方便的调节,以使患者的体位能有效与手术操作相配合。In the actual lithotomy position operation, the posture of the patient greatly affects the progress of the operation, and inappropriate leg posture can also easily cause leg circulation problems or muscle strain problems to the patient. Therefore, it is particularly important to adjust the posture of the legs during the operation, and this adjustment should be multi-degree-of-freedom, that is, it can be adjusted conveniently in different angles and directions, so that the patient's position can be effectively aligned with the surgical operation. match.
一种多自由度小儿截石位体位架,包括固定卡21、立杆5和连接杆10,所述的立杆5设置一对,通过连接杆10连接;立杆5的底部活动式安装在固定卡21中,连接杆10上设置一对支杆15,支杆15底部通过万向装置设置有腿托16。A multi-degree-of-freedom pediatric lithotomy position frame, comprising a fixed card 21, a vertical rod 5 and a connecting rod 10, a pair of the vertical rods 5 are arranged and connected by the connecting rod 10; the bottom of the vertical rod 5 is movably installed on the In the fixed card 21, a pair of struts 15 are arranged on the connecting rod 10, and the bottom of the struts 15 is provided with a leg support 16 through a universal device.
与传统的体位架不同,本方案中体位架采用双侧固定的方式,两侧分别通过固定卡21固定在手术床边,立杆5用于支撑,然后用连接杆10对两个立杆5进行连接加固。连接杆10最好垂直立杆5设置,并且连接杆10应该是可拆卸的,方便安装。立杆5的底部活动式安装在固定卡21中,可以在固定卡21中转动,以调整立杆5与手术床之间的角度。这个调整既可以影响腿托16的高度,又能影响腿托16的角度。腿托16用来放置患者的腿部,与传统的约束带相比,腿托16与患者腿部接触面积更大,有效分散了压力,防止过度束缚造成血液流动不畅。腿托16通过万向装置安装在支杆15上,可在支杆15上调整其角度、朝向,极大地方便了腿托16位置的调整。至于两个腿托16之间的距离,可通过滑动支杆15在连接杆10上的位置来调整,以充分暴露手术位。支杆15顶部连接有调位套9,支杆15通过调位套9固定安装在连接杆10上,保证使用过程的稳定性。Different from the traditional posture frame, the posture frame in this scheme adopts the method of bilateral fixing, and the two sides are respectively fixed on the side of the operating bed by the fixing card 21, and the vertical rod 5 is used for support, and then the connecting rod 10 is used to pair the two vertical rods 5 Strengthen the connection. The connecting rod 10 is preferably arranged vertically to the vertical pole 5, and the connecting rod 10 should be detachable for easy installation. The bottom of the vertical rod 5 is movably installed in the fixed card 21, and can be rotated in the fixed card 21 to adjust the angle between the vertical rod 5 and the operating bed. This adjustment can affect both the height of the leg rest 16 and the angle of the leg rest 16 . The leg support 16 is used to place the patient's leg. Compared with the traditional restraint belt, the leg support 16 has a larger contact area with the patient's leg, which effectively disperses the pressure and prevents excessive restraint from causing poor blood flow. The leg rest 16 is installed on the pole 15 through a universal device, and its angle and orientation can be adjusted on the pole 15, which greatly facilitates the adjustment of the position of the leg rest 16. As for the distance between the two leg rests 16, it can be adjusted by sliding the position of the strut 15 on the connecting rod 10, so as to fully expose the operation position. A positioning sleeve 9 is connected to the top of the pole 15, and the pole 15 is fixedly installed on the connecting rod 10 through the positioning sleeve 9 to ensure the stability during use.
支杆15是可伸缩杆,支杆15上设置有调整支杆15长短的旋钮,可进行腿托16位置的上下微调,方便调节过程。The pole 15 is a telescopic pole, and the pole 15 is provided with a knob for adjusting the length of the pole 15, which can be fine-tuned up and down the position of the leg rest 16 to facilitate the adjustment process.
如图1所示,本方案中给出了一种固定卡21结构,包括两个平行设置的横板和垂直连接这两个横板的竖板,在竖板中沿垂直于横板的方向开设有与竖板的一个侧面贯通的盘槽4,盘槽4中通过转轴安装有转盘3,所述的立杆5固定在转盘3上。As shown in Figure 1, a fixed card 21 structure is provided in this plan, including two horizontal plates arranged in parallel and a vertical plate vertically connecting the two horizontal plates, in the vertical plate along the direction perpendicular to the horizontal plate There is a disc groove 4 penetrating with one side of the riser, a turntable 3 is installed in the disc groove 4 through a rotating shaft, and the vertical rod 5 is fixed on the turntable 3 .
用于和立杆5连接的为转盘3,转盘3可在盘槽4中转动,盘槽4的一端和竖板侧面贯通,这样整个体位架可以向着盘槽4贯通的一面转动,使整个体位架可以放倒在手术床端部,而不用进行单独的收纳,不需要使用时,节省空间。转盘3转动时,带动立杆5调整位置。The turntable 3 is used to connect with the pole 5, and the turntable 3 can rotate in the disk groove 4. One end of the disk groove 4 is connected with the side of the vertical plate, so that the whole posture frame can rotate toward the side of the disk groove 4, so that the whole posture The rack can be laid down at the end of the operating bed without separate storage, saving space when not in use. When the turntable 3 rotates, it drives the vertical rod 5 to adjust the position.
转盘3上沿圆周方向分布有多个栓孔2,在竖板上设置有与栓孔2对应的通孔,通孔中转配有固定栓1,固定栓1从通孔中伸入到转盘3上的一个栓孔2中时,转盘3不能再转动。A plurality of bolt holes 2 are distributed along the circumferential direction on the turntable 3, and through holes corresponding to the bolt holes 2 are arranged on the vertical plate. The through holes are equipped with fixed bolts 1, and the fixed bolts 1 extend into the turntable 3 from the through holes. When in a bolt hole 2 on the top, the turntable 3 can no longer rotate.
对于转盘3的固定采用固定栓1,在竖板上设置有一个通孔,这个通孔位于栓孔2分布的圆周在竖板上的对应位置。那么当通孔与其中一个栓孔2的轴线重合时,可直接将固定栓1从通孔塞入到栓孔2中,阻止转盘3继续转动,这样就起到了固定转盘3位置的作用。图1中为了更清楚表现转盘3结构,对竖板部分做了透视处理。Fixing bolt 1 is adopted for the fixing of rotating disk 3, and a through hole is provided on the vertical plate, and this through hole is located at the corresponding position of the circumference of bolt hole 2 distribution on the vertical plate. Then when the through hole coincides with the axis of one of the bolt holes 2, the fixed bolt 1 can be directly inserted into the bolt hole 2 from the through hole to prevent the rotating disk 3 from continuing to rotate, thus playing the role of fixing the position of the rotating disk 3. In Fig. 1, in order to show the structure of the turntable 3 more clearly, the perspective processing is done on the vertical plate part.
如图4所示,竖板的侧面设置有表盘刻度29,用来精确指示立杆5的转动角度,即立杆5相对于床板转动时,可通过竖板侧面上的表盘刻度29来对应其旋转的角度,使旋转角度更加精确。As shown in Figure 4, the side of the riser is provided with a dial scale 29, which is used to accurately indicate the rotation angle of the vertical rod 5, that is, when the vertical rod 5 rotates relative to the bed board, the dial scale 29 on the side of the riser can correspond to the angle of rotation of the vertical rod 5. The angle of rotation makes the rotation angle more precise.
固定板8是安装在手术床两端的,两个平行设置的横板中,穿过其中一个横板设置有第三旋钮23,第三旋钮23的端部规定设置有推板22,旋动第三旋钮23可改变推板22在两个横板之间的位置。The fixing plate 8 is installed on both ends of the operating bed. Among the two horizontal plates arranged in parallel, a third knob 23 is provided through one of the horizontal plates. The end of the third knob 23 is provided with a push plate 22. The three knobs 23 can change the position of the push plate 22 between the two horizontal plates.
固定板8的纵向截面是凹形的,安装时将手术床的床板咬合在两个横板之间,然后通过第三旋钮23进行紧固。第三旋钮23旋动时,推板22不断靠近床板,并将床板推向横板,最终使床板固定在推板22和一个横板之间,起到固定整个体位架的作用。The longitudinal section of the fixing plate 8 is concave, and the bed plate of the operating bed is engaged between two horizontal plates during installation, and then fastened by the third knob 23 . When the third knob 23 was rotated, the push plate 22 was constantly approaching the bed board, and the bed board was pushed to the horizontal plate, and finally the bed board was fixed between the push plate 22 and a horizontal plate, which played the role of fixing the whole posture frame.
腿托16的高低位置是可调的,具体方式是:The height position of leg rest 16 is adjustable, and specific mode is:
连接杆10铰接在其端部设置的固定板8上,固定板8通过滑套7活动式安装在立杆5上,滑套7上设置有用于固定滑套7位置的第一旋钮6。The connecting rod 10 is hinged on the fixed plate 8 provided at its end, the fixed plate 8 is movably installed on the vertical rod 5 through the sliding sleeve 7, and the sliding sleeve 7 is provided with a first knob 6 for fixing the position of the sliding sleeve 7 .
腿托16通过支杆15安装在连接杆10上,那么调整连接杆10的高度就间接调整了腿托16的高度。连接杆10端部设置固定板8,固定板8可以通过滑套7在立杆5上滑动,调整高度位置,调整好后,利用第一旋钮6固定。安装整个体位架时,可以将连接杆10从立杆5上端取下,先安装两个固定卡21,然后再套装上连接杆10。Leg rest 16 is installed on the connecting rod 10 by pole 15, so adjusting the height of connecting rod 10 has just adjusted the height of leg rest 16 indirectly. A fixed plate 8 is arranged at the end of the connecting rod 10, and the fixed plate 8 can slide on the vertical rod 5 through the sliding sleeve 7 to adjust the height position. After adjusting, the first knob 6 is used to fix it. When installing the whole posture frame, the connecting rod 10 can be taken off from the upper end of the vertical rod 5, and two fixing clips 21 are installed first, and then the connecting rod 10 is sheathed.
连接杆10上靠近固定板8的一侧开设有滑槽13,在滑槽13中通过键装配有卡套11,使卡套11可沿滑槽13滑动但不能转动;卡套11外壁上设置有卡板12,在连接杆10与固定板8接触位置的固定板8上沿圆周方向布设有多个与卡板12配合的卡孔14。One side near the fixed plate 8 on the connecting rod 10 is provided with a chute 13, and a ferrule 11 is fitted with a key in the chute 13, so that the ferrule 11 can slide along the chute 13 but cannot rotate; There is a clamping plate 12 , and a plurality of clamping holes 14 matching with the clamping plate 12 are arranged along the circumferential direction on the fixing plate 8 at the contact position between the connecting rod 10 and the fixing plate 8 .
连接杆10是可以转动的,以调整腿托16的角度,腿托16角度调整好之后,可以利用卡套11进行固定。卡套11可以沿着连接杆10滑动,但不能转动,卡套11上的卡板12伸入到固定板8上的卡孔14中时,卡套11受到卡止。由于卡套11和连接杆10采用键配合的方式,卡套11不能转动,则连接杆10也不能转动。因此在调整好连接杆10的转动角度后,仅需要将卡套11推入到固定板8上的卡孔14中,即实现了连接杆10位置的固定。The connecting rod 10 is rotatable to adjust the angle of the leg rest 16. After the angle of the leg rest 16 is adjusted, it can be fixed by the ferrule 11. The ferrule 11 can slide along the connecting rod 10, but cannot rotate. When the clamping plate 12 on the ferrule 11 extends into the clamping hole 14 on the fixing plate 8, the ferrule 11 is locked. Since the ferrule 11 and the connecting rod 10 adopt a key fit mode, the ferrule 11 cannot rotate, and the connecting rod 10 cannot rotate either. Therefore, after adjusting the rotation angle of the connecting rod 10 , it is only necessary to push the ferrule 11 into the clamping hole 14 on the fixing plate 8 , that is, the position of the connecting rod 10 is fixed.
本方案中,腿托16包括弧形板,弧形板上设置有紧固带17。这种腿托16结构使患者腿部能有更大接触面,有效分散了压力,而紧固带17可以辅助固定。In this solution, the leg support 16 includes an arc-shaped plate, and a fastening belt 17 is arranged on the arc-shaped plate. This leg support 16 structure enables the patient's legs to have a larger contact surface, which effectively disperses the pressure, and the fastening belt 17 can assist in fixing.
为了能使腿托16的角度能通过各个方式进行调整,本方案中还设置了万向装置,万向装置包括内部带有凹腔的球套18,凹腔中装配有可在凹腔中转动但不能从凹腔中脱出的圆球24,圆球24与一个伸出凹腔的连接柱25连接,连接柱25端部设置有与腿托16配合的安装板26;穿过球套18的侧壁设置有第二旋钮20,第二旋钮20的端部可与圆球24接触。In order to enable the angle of the leg rest 16 to be adjusted in various ways, a universal device is also provided in this program. The universal device includes a ball sleeve 18 with a concave cavity inside. But the ball 24 that can not escape from the concave cavity, the ball 24 is connected with a connecting column 25 stretching out from the concave cavity, and the connecting column 25 ends are provided with a mounting plate 26 that cooperates with the leg holder 16; The side wall is provided with a second knob 20 , and the end of the second knob 20 can be in contact with the ball 24 .
如图3所示,万向装置可带动腿托16在大范围内调整角度,角度调整好之后,通过旋动第二旋钮20,使第二旋钮20的端部与圆球24接触,对圆球24进行紧固和束缚,使圆球24不能继续转动,这样就对腿托16的位置进行了良好的固定。支杆15底部垂直于支杆15设置有托板19,所述的万向装置设置在托板19上。As shown in Figure 3, the universal device can drive the leg support 16 to adjust the angle in a wide range. After the angle is adjusted, by turning the second knob 20, the end of the second knob 20 is in contact with the ball 24. The ball 24 is fastened and bound so that the ball 24 cannot continue to rotate, so that the position of the leg rest 16 is well fixed. A supporting plate 19 is arranged on the bottom of the supporting rod 15 perpendicular to the supporting rod 15 , and the universal device is arranged on the supporting plate 19 .
本装置提供了一种多自由度的调整机构,可利用转盘3、滑套7、卡套11、万向装置全方位、多角度地进行腿托16位置、高度、角度等的调整,调节方式多样化,可在实际当中根据情况选择最便捷的调整方式。这种体位架为患者截石位提供了全面的调节方式,有利于手术的顺利进行,同时降低了患者腿部出现拉伤、循环不畅的几率,其结构简单,制作方便,适宜推广使用。This device provides a multi-degree-of-freedom adjustment mechanism, which can use the turntable 3, sliding sleeve 7, ferrule 11, and universal device to adjust the position, height, angle, etc. Diversification, you can choose the most convenient adjustment method according to the actual situation. This posture frame provides a comprehensive adjustment method for the patient's lithotomy position, which is conducive to the smooth operation of the operation, and at the same time reduces the chance of straining the patient's leg and poor circulation. It has a simple structure and is convenient to manufacture, and is suitable for popularization and use.
本装置安装好并调整了腿托16的位置之后,立杆5可能处于倾斜状态,即立杆5与床板之间呈锐角。这种情况下患者双腿搭在腿托16上之后,将给固定栓1部分带来很大的压力;同时固定卡21部分也将承受较大压力。为了解决这个问题,设置了加固杆27结构。加固杆27为可伸缩杆,其上设置有调节旋钮,并且加固杆27是铰接在立杆5上的。当立杆5处于倾斜状态时,可将加固杆27旋转至倾斜的方向,并调整加固杆27的长度,使加固杆前端的支撑板28支撑在床面上,这样就构成了一种三角支撑结构,使整个装置稳定性更佳。加固杆27在两个立杆5上各设置一个,但位于不同侧。加固杆27在立杆5上铰接处设置有挡板,限制加固杆27的旋转位置。整个装置收纳时,可将加固杆27缩短,并旋转至与立杆5贴合。After the device has been installed and the position of the leg rest 16 has been adjusted, the upright bar 5 may be in an inclined state, that is, an acute angle is formed between the upright bar 5 and the bed board. In this case, after the patient's legs rest on the leg support 16, a large pressure will be brought to the fixed bolt 1 part; simultaneously, the fixed card 21 part will also bear greater pressure. In order to solve this problem, a reinforcing rod 27 structure is provided. The reinforcing rod 27 is a telescopic rod on which an adjustment knob is arranged, and the reinforcing rod 27 is hinged on the vertical rod 5 . When the vertical bar 5 is in an inclined state, the reinforcing bar 27 can be rotated to the inclined direction, and the length of the reinforcing bar 27 can be adjusted so that the support plate 28 at the front end of the reinforcing bar is supported on the bed surface, thus forming a triangular support The structure makes the whole device more stable. Reinforcing rods 27 are provided one on each of the two uprights 5, but on different sides. The reinforcement rod 27 is provided with a baffle plate at the hinge on the vertical rod 5 to limit the rotation position of the reinforcement rod 27 . When the whole device is stored, the reinforcing rod 27 can be shortened and rotated to fit with the vertical rod 5 .
